summaryrefslogtreecommitdiffstats
path: root/src/tests
diff options
context:
space:
mode:
authorKen Raeburn <raeburn@mit.edu>2009-11-06 20:16:53 +0000
committerKen Raeburn <raeburn@mit.edu>2009-11-06 20:16:53 +0000
commit965c41375099ee25440ee09e9b4a2db56ca7d7e0 (patch)
treefb2acf21e055a2b204a50a44573e6cbe6d6c93fd /src/tests
parent09d926126e61517bb28809d79281e9c76bbced21 (diff)
downloadkrb5-965c41375099ee25440ee09e9b4a2db56ca7d7e0.tar.gz
krb5-965c41375099ee25440ee09e9b4a2db56ca7d7e0.tar.xz
krb5-965c41375099ee25440ee09e9b4a2db56ca7d7e0.zip
Use krb5_get_error_message for reporting if krb5_get_server_rcache fails
git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@23137 dc483132-0cff-0310-8789-dd5450dbe970
Diffstat (limited to 'src/tests')
-rw-r--r--src/tests/threads/t_rcache.c8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/tests/threads/t_rcache.c b/src/tests/threads/t_rcache.c
index eb94b2eaf5..e3416f23c5 100644
--- a/src/tests/threads/t_rcache.c
+++ b/src/tests/threads/t_rcache.c
@@ -78,7 +78,9 @@ static void try_one (struct tinfo *t)
#ifndef INIT_ONCE
err = krb5_get_server_rcache(ctx, &piece, &my_rcache);
if (err) {
- com_err(prog, err, "getting replay cache");
+ const char *msg = krb5_get_error_message(ctx, err);
+ fprintf(stderr, "%s while initializing replay cache\n", msg);
+ krb5_free_error_message(ctx, msg);
exit(1);
}
#else
@@ -134,7 +136,9 @@ int main (int argc, char *argv[])
#ifdef INIT_ONCE
err = krb5_get_server_rcache(ctx, &piece, &rcache);
if (err) {
- com_err(prog, err, "getting replay cache");
+ const char *msg = krb5_get_error_message(ctx, err);
+ fprintf(stderr, "%s: %s while initializing replay cache\n", prog, msg);
+ krb5_free_error_message(ctx, msg);
return 1;
}
#endif